/* Дизайн и вёрстка сайта выполнены специалистами студии Алексея Кравченко */

.menu { background:url(/imgs/sub-logo-bg.gif) left top; background-repeat:no-repeat;margin:0px}
.menu div.block { margin:0px 0px 100px 165px; padding:0px 10px 0px 10px; }
.menu div.block span.sortmenu { color:#4c4a4b; font:14px Tahoma; margin:5px 0px 5px 0px; display:block; padding:3px 0px 3px 5px }
.menu div.block span.text { color:#5b5a5a; font:12px Arial; margin:5px 5px 5px 5px; display:block; }
.menu a { text-decoration:none; font:14px Arial; color:#7f7f7f; text-decoration:none; padding:4px 15px;  clear:both; margin:2px 0px; }

.menuitem {height:20px}
.menuitem a{font-size: 14px;text-decoration: none;color: #4c4a4b}
.menuitem a:hover {font-size: 14px;	text-decoration: none; font-weight: normal;	color: #db3f82}
.headmenu {background:url(/imgs/head-menu-bg.gif) repeat-x; height:35px;}

.ten {text-align: left;	font-size: 17px; line-height: 36px; font-family: Tahoma; font-weight: normal; position: relative; padding-left: 5px; color: #555c65; zoom: 1; text-shadow: #000 0 0}
.ten span { position: absolute; top: -1px;left: -1px;	padding-left: 5px;	color: #FFF;	width: 540px;}
.ten a {color:#FFF; text-decoration:none;  font-weight:normal;}


h2	 { padding:0px; margin:10px 5px 10px 20px; font:17px "Tahoma"; color:#8a1f3f; }

div.v1 ul {list-style:circle; }

.v1 {padding:0px 10px 20px 10px; font:14px Arial; color:#363535; text-align:justify}
.v1 a{font-famyly:Arial; font-size:16px Arial; color:#ca3975; text-align:justify; text-transform:uppercase; text-decoration:none}
.v1 a:hover {text-decoration:underline}
div.v1 {width:550px}
p.v1 { margin:5px 0px; }

.v2 {padding:0px 10px 20px 10px; font:14px Arial; color:#363535; text-align:justify}
.v2 a{font-famyly:Arial; font-size:16px Arial; color:#4f7082; text-align:justify; text-decoration:none}
.v2 a:hover {text-decoration:underline}
div.v2 {width:550px}
p.v2 { margin:5px 0px; }

.v3 {padding:0px 10px 20px 10px; font:14px Arial; color:#363535; text-align:justify}
.v3 a{font-famyly:Arial; font-size:16px Arial; color:#ca3975; text-align:justify; text-decoration:none}
.v3 a:hover {text-decoration:underline}
div.v3 {width:550px}
p.v3 { margin:5px 0px; }

span.orgname { font:normal 11px Arial; color:#7a8695; }
.address {background:url(/imgs/sort-foto.gif) top no-repeat; width:247px; height:195px;padding:10px 0px 0px 5px}
.sort {background:url(/imgs/sort-bg.gif) top no-repeat; width:247px; height:178px;}
.sort2 {background:url(/imgs/sort-bg2.gif) top no-repeat; width:247px; height:195px;}
#content { background:url(/imgs/sub-right-star.gif) top right no-repeat; }

.info {  }
.info dd { color:#707070; font:11px Arial; }
.info dt { color:#909090; font:11px Arial; }
.footer {background:url(/imgs/foot-bg.gif) left center repeat-x; height:62px}
.footer1 {background:url(/imgs/foot-1.gif) left center no-repeat; height:62px}
.footer2 {background:url(/imgs/foot-2.gif) right center no-repeat; height:62px}
.footerm {background:url(/imgs/foot-mid.gif) center no-repeat; height:62px}
/* навигация */

.nav a:hover { color:#444; background:#f5f5f5; }
.nav a.sel:hover { color:#5e0b24; }

